Around the Palais de Justice, the ancient courthouse and regional parliament, a masterpiece of medieval and renaissance architecture.
The 2 photos with a large portrait represent Dominique Laboubée, charismatic leader of the The Dogs, one of the jewels of French punk rock of the 20th century. He was from Rouen, and the city paid tribute to him with this painting by street artist Jeff Aerosol.
The Dogs best album was "Too Much Class for the Neighborhood." I couldn't have said it better...
